RUSSELL DICKERSON
Multiplatinum Nashville-based
singer, songwriter, and multi-instrumentalist Russell Dickerson has established
himself a prolific songwriter and powerhouse showman through good old-fashioned
performances and eloquent songcraft spiked with spirit. In 2017, his
gold-certified full-length debut, Yours, bowed at #5 on the Billboard
Top Country Albums Chart and #1 on the Emerging Artists Chart. Not to mention,
it yielded three consecutive #1 smashes, including the double-platinum “Yours”
(christened “One of the hottest wedding songs of the year” by The
Knot), the platinum “Blue Tacoma,” and “Every Little Thing.” Nominations
followed at the Academy of Country Music Awards, CMT Music Awards, and
iHeartRadio Music Awards. Among many highlights in 2020, he received a nod in
the category of “Best New Male Artist of the Year” at the ACM. Plus, he
has electrified audiences on tour with the likes of Thomas Rhett, Florida
Georgia Line, Darius, Lady A, and Kane Brown in addition to bringing the “RD
Party” to sold out venues everywhere as a headliner. Attracting a fervent
following on social media (fondly referred to as “RD Fam”), he launched
his own YouTube show, “This Is Russ,” bringing viewers deeper
into his world. In 2020, he transposes
the little pleasures into hummable and heartfelt heartfelt country anthems
uplifted by pop energy on his second full-length album, Southern Symphony
[Triple Tigers], led by the singles “Love You Like I Used To,” “Home Sweet,”
and “Never Gets Old.” The record reflects every side of his personality—from
the loving husband, self-proclaimed “regular dude,” and now dad
at home to the boisterous and bold presence beloved by millions on stage.
Russell tells his story like never before through eloquent songcraft and
airtight playing.
Eddie Montgomery of
Montgomery Gentry
Average Joes Entertainment’s Eddie Montgomery of Montgomery
Gentry recently released "Outskirts," a seven-song EP. With 20 plus
charted singles, the Kentucky native has earned CMA, ACM, and GRAMMY awards and
nominations with undeniable blue collar anthems like “Hell Yeah,” “My
Town,” and “Hillbilly Shoes." They’ve notched five No. 1 singles, "If
You Ever Stop Loving Me," "Something To Be Proud Of,"
"Lucky Man," "Back When I Knew It All" and "Roll With
Me." They were inducted as Grand Ole Opry members in 2009 and were
inducted into the Kentucky Music Hall of Fame in 2015.
